At Consensus Miami 2026, ChangeNOW is taking a central role in industry discussions, participating in a series of high-profile panels focused on infrastructure resilience, tokenization, and the barriers to mainstream crypto adoption. The non-custodial exchange, part of the broader NOW ecosystem, will have its Chief Strategy Officer Pauline Shangett moderate and speak across multiple sessions starting May 5.

On May 6, Shangett leads two consecutive panels organized by NOWNodes, the blockchain node infrastructure arm of the NOW ecosystem. The first, “Trust Under Pressure: Can Tokenized Systems Stay Consistent at Scale?” (10:35–11:10 AM), tackles the critical risks of data inconsistencies in tokenized real-world assets (RWAs). Panelists from Crypto.com, Zerion, Solflare, and LI.FI will confront the tangible costs of system failures when real money is at stake. The second session, “Selling Trust: Can RWA Deliver on the Promise of Mass Adoption?” (11:15–11:45 AM), moderated by Samuel Hood Burke of CCN, examines why tokenized treasuries, real estate, and other RWAs haven’t achieved mass adoption, with speakers from Houdini Swap, TON Foundation, Paxos, and GlobalStake.

Shangett’s involvement extends beyond these panels. On May 5, she speaks at the Capital Markets Summit on on-chain privacy and identity (11:25 AM) and later joins “FQ Trust by Design: Building On-Chain Systems People Believe In” (1:20 PM). On May 7, she participates in “The Next Commodity Revolution: RWA Meets Instant Liquidity” at 4:40 PM. Across all appearances, the recurring theme is what it takes to build financial systems that earn user trust.

ChangeNOW, founded in 2017, provides cross-chain swaps across 110+ blockchains and 1,500+ assets without holding user funds, serving over eight million users. The discussions mirror real-world challenges the company’s infrastructure handles daily. The panels reflect no product launch but a strategic effort to shape the conversation on trust, scale, and adoption.
